Understanding the Dior Bowling Bag Family:
The term "Dior bowling bag" encompasses a range of styles and sizes, each with its own unique characteristics. While the classic bowling bag shape – a sturdy, rounded silhouette – remains consistent, variations in size, material, hardware, and embellishments create a diverse collection. To better understand the nuances, let's explore some key variations within the Dior bowling bag family:
* Christian Dior Bowling Bag (General): This overarching category encompasses the various styles and iterations of Dior bowling bags produced throughout the brand's history. The common denominator is the bowling bag's signature shape and often the inclusion of the Dior logo, either subtly embossed or prominently displayed. These bags often feature high-quality leather, durable construction, and sophisticated details.
* Dior Groove 25 Bag: This specific style typically features a slightly more structured shape than some other bowling bags, often with a distinct “groove” or textured detail along the sides or bottom of the bag. The "25" likely refers to the approximate size in centimeters, though this can vary slightly depending on the specific production run. The Dior Groove 25 often showcases the brand's logo prominently, either as a metal plaque or embossed into the leather.
* Dior Vibe Hobo Bag: While technically a hobo bag, some Dior Vibe bags share stylistic similarities with bowling bags, particularly in their rounded shape and spacious interior. The Vibe hobo often features a softer, more slouchy silhouette compared to the structured form of a traditional bowling bag. This style often emphasizes a more casual and relaxed aesthetic.
* Dior Groove 20 Bag: Similar to the Groove 25, this smaller version maintains the signature groove detail but offers a more compact size, ideal for everyday use or carrying essential items. The "20" again likely denotes the approximate size in centimeters.
* Dior Bowler Bag: This term is often used interchangeably with "bowling bag," particularly when referring to the classic, rounded shape. However, "bowler bag" can sometimes imply a slightly more structured and rigid design compared to some of the softer, more slouchy bowling bag variations.
